AIR SIDE SYSTEM

In consideration of safety, the system load of an air conditioning system is usually excessively large in design. As a result, the capacity of energy transmission and distribution equipment of the system (e.g. fan) and the terminal heat exchanger drastically exceed actual needs. Systematic strategy can be used for optimizing fan coil system.

  • The optimal energy-efficiency Control system adjusts the volume of air supply to control the humidity and temperature within air conditioned areas. When the load in air conditioned area is lower than design load, the controls can supply less air volume to the system in order to save the system operation energy consumption.
  • In addition to reducing operation energy consumption, the control system optimizes the temperature difference of AC air supply to satisfy occupant’s comfort.
  • CO2 detector is used to control supply volume of outdoor fresh air. Based on the hygiene requirements, fresh air shall be minimized in summer and winter, and maximized (even to full fresh air) during transitional seasons according to outdoor air conditions.
